PHP中__destruct(),类的析构函数

析构方法是PHP5才引进的新内容。
析造方法的声明格式与构造方法 __construct() 比较类似,也是以两个下划线开始的方法 __destruct() ,这种析构方法名称也是固定的。

析构方法允许在销毁一个类之前执行的一些操作或完成一些功能,比如说关闭文件、释放结果集等。

public __destruct(){
//do something

}

析构方法没有返回值,主要作用是释放资源的操作,并不是销毁对象本身.在销毁对象前,系统自动的调用该类的析构方法 一个类最多只有一个析构方法。

你可能感兴趣的:(PHP中__destruct(),类的析构函数)